Will Barnet-Inspired Figure Drawing Workshop
October 3 @ 10:00 am - 2:00 pm

Explore AMFA’s exhibition Will Barnet: Seasons of Life and create drawings inspired by the expressive portrayal of the human figure.
Experiment with charcoal, graphite, and pastels while developing your drawing techniques. The workshop includes a live model session, providing the opportunity to apply these skills through direct observation.
Whether you are a beginner or refining your skills, you will enjoy receiving expert instruction and practical guidance to capture a moment in time.
Students must be 18+ to attend, as the workshop will feature an undraped model.
